phaz0rz 06-30-2020 07:12 AM

Re: Can you sign up with Adyen directly?
 
They are the backend payment processor but this is eBay's show so I'm pretty sure you would have to apply directly with eBay.

The difference between Adyen and Paypal, IMO, is that Adyen is designed to be seamlessly integrated with any e-commerce website without the Adyen brand being promoted. Paypal on the other hand is designed to be much more up front, dealing directly with customers, with their branding everywhere they're accepted.

An application directly with Adyen would probably be an application to integrate their payment platform into your website or app, not to sell on eBay.
